;;; meese.el --- protect the impressionable young minds of America ;; This is in the public domain on account of being distributed since ;; 1985 or 1986 without a copyright notice. ;; Maintainer: FSF ;; Keywords: games ;;; Code: (defun protect-innocence-hook () (if (and (equal (file-name-nondirectory buffer-file-name) "sex.6") (not (y-or-n-p "Are you over 18? "))) (progn (clear-visited-file-modtime) (setq buffer-file-name (concat (file-name-directory buffer-file-name) "celibacy.1")) (let (buffer-read-only) ; otherwise (erase-buffer) may bomb. (erase-buffer) (insert-file-contents buffer-file-name t)) (rename-buffer (file-name-nondirectory buffer-file-name))))) (or (memq 'protect-innocence-hook find-file-hooks) (setq find-file-hooks (cons 'protect-innocence-hook find-file-hooks))) ;;; meese.el ends here
